Association of Cardiac Biomarkers With Cardiovascular Outcomes in Patients With Psoriatic Arthritis and Psoriasis: A Longitudinal Cohort Study.

Keith ColacoKer-Ai LeeShadi AkhtariRaz WinerPaul I WelshNaveed SattarIain B McInnesVinod ChandranPaula HarveyRichard J CookDafna D GladmanVincent PiguetLihi Eder
Published in: Arthritis & rheumatology (Hoboken, N.J.) (2022)
In patients with PsD, cTnI may reflect the burden of atherosclerosis, independent of traditional cardiovascular risk factors. Cardiac troponin I and NT-proBNP are associated with incident cardiovascular events independent of the FRS, but further study of their role in cardiovascular risk stratification is warranted.
